Watford legend, Troy Deeney has revealed the four major challenges manager Erik ten Hag faces at Manchester United.
He said the Old Trafford boss is ‘convinced’ about just one of his defenders at the club.
The former Watford man further described Manchester United right back, Aaron Wan-Bissaka as a forgotten man but advised the player to remain at the club in as much as he is getting paid.
Manchester United sufferred their heaviest defeats under Ten Hag to Brentford and Manchester City.
They have gone on to win seven of his 11 matches overall.
Deeney reckons that one of Ten Hag’s issues is that defender Lisandro Martinez is the only one at his disposal that he is ‘entirely convinced about’.
Deeney told The Sun: “It is clear that he[Ten Hag] has grave reservations about his backline with Lisandro Martinez the only defender he is entirely convinced about.
‘We do not know yet whether Casemiro is up to speed and whether he is “the answer” to United’s long-standing midfield problem, and up front it’s clear Ten Hag hasn’t settled on the central striker or the wide-left player he wants.
“And then there is the problem of off-loading so many good players, on very good money, who have not convinced at Old Trafford.
“If I was in the position of someone like Aaron Wan-Bissaka — who could end up as a forgotten man — I’d probably sit tight, knowing I’m being paid well. Most players would.”
